Tory Burch sits in the premium fashion space, with a look and price point that feel elevated but not ultra-exclusive. The brand offers polished design, quality materials, and strong name appeal. It does not have the rarefied status of top-tier heritage luxury houses. So, it reads as accessible luxury or premium luxury rather than true couture.

Applying the Criteria to Tory Burch : Quick Verdict
You’ll want to weigh Tory Burch’s heritage and craftsmanship against its price point and positioning to see where it sits on the luxury spectrum. The brand has clear roots and recognizable design DNA, but its accessible prices and wide availability pull it toward contemporary rather than traditional luxury.

Tory Burch Quality & Craftsmanship vs. Heritage Luxury
You’ll want to weigh Tory Burch’s materials and construction against the deep heritage craftsmanship of old luxury houses to see where it stands. The brand uses quality leathers and modern techniques that feel elevated, but its relatively recent 2004 origin means it lacks the centuries-old artisan lineage of heritage labels.
